Misconception 3: LASIK Is Always a Long-term Service



While LASIK is an efficient treatment for dealing with vision, it's an usual misunderstanding that the outcomes are constantly long-term. Your eyes can transform as you age, which could result in changes in your vision.

Variables like presbyopia, cataracts, or various other age-related changes can still influence your eyesight also after LASIK. Several clients appreciate clear vision for years, yet some may require glasses or get in touches with once more later.

It is essential to have realistic assumptions and recognize that LASIK can considerably boost vision yet does not assure long-lasting results. Routine eye check-ups can aid check any kind of modifications, guaranteeing you stay educated about your vision wellness.

Myth 4: LASIK Surgery Is Incredibly Uncomfortable



One usual false impression regarding LASIK surgical treatment is that it's incredibly unpleasant, but that's much from the truth. A lot of patients report only mild pain during the treatment.

Your doctor will utilize numbing eye drops to ensure your eyes fit throughout the process. You may really feel some stress and a small feeling, yet it's usually short and workable.

After the surgical treatment, any type of pain is normally light and can be conveniently relieved with non-prescription pain relievers. Lots of people describe the experience as being less agonizing than they prepared for.

In fact, the majority of clients are stunned at exactly how quick and very easy the procedure is, frequently going back to their daily activities shortly after.

Myth 6: LASIK Is a Quick Fix Without Dangers



Many people mistakenly believe that LASIK is an easy, quick fix for vision troubles with no affiliated risks. While it holds true that LASIK can significantly enhance your vision, it's essential to understand that it's not without its possible complications.

Like any procedure, it lugs risks, including completely dry eyes, glare, halos, and, in unusual instances, vision loss. You require to weigh these risks versus the benefits meticulously.

It's additionally essential to remember that LASIK isn't suitable for every person. Aspects like your eye health and wellness, prescription security, and age play significant roles in identifying your candidateship.

Misconception 7: You Do Not Required a Thorough Examination Before LASIK



A comprehensive evaluation prior to LASIK is important to ensure the procedure is right for you. Many individuals think they can skip this action, however that's a false impression.

Throughout the examination, your eye surgeon examines your vision, gauges the density of your cornea, and look for any type of underlying health and wellness concerns that could impact the outcome. This thorough assessment aids figure out if you're an appropriate prospect for LASIK and describes any possible dangers.

Avoiding the examination can lead to issues or unsuitable outcomes, leaving you with more issues than services.
